It's a local event that's well known enough that most folks get the story from a simple "Jungle walk date set!" The jungle walk is a day long rally in Sikeston, MO that features a short (50-200 round) course through a ravine with targets of varying sizes, an "ammo dump" for people who just want to unload a hundred rounds quickly, a swap meet for folks who collect class three guns, vintage guns, unusual guns, and explosives. The local SWAT team does a couple of demos, and there may be a cannon match. If you bring a good supply of factory ammo, there are loaner guns to run the Jungle walk, and they usually charge $10 or something similar to participate in the ammo dump (using provided guns and ammo). Hearing protection is HIGHLY recommended. The event itself is usually free and kid friendly, but contact the organizer for more info before traveling long distance. See http://www.semissourian.com/story/1538023.html for past coverage. FWIW, the June subgun match at the Missouri Bootheel Pistol Club is much more of a competitive match and less of a demo day.
